They also shared real stories of families who accidentally made costly mistakes—like leaving money directly to their child and unintentionally disqualifying them from benefits.


Planning for Housing, Not Just Dollars

As a Realtor, I know families want answers about housing. Steve & Nelson explained how real estate can be titled inside a trust to give your child a safe place to live without jeopardizing benefits.

We talked about how financial planning intersects with legal, medical, and housing decisions, and why having a coordinated plan is the only real protection.
